What Is Tree Pruning & Why It Matters

Tree pruning (also called tree trimming) is the selective removal of dead, diseased, or overgrown branches. It differs from tree removal because the goal is to preserve the tree’s health, shape, and structural integrity.

Key Definitions

  • Structural Pruning: Focuses on the tree’s framework to prevent future breakage.
  • Thinning: Removes crowded branches to improve light penetration and air flow.
  • Crown Reduction: Reduces overall height for safety and aesthetic reasons.

Best Seasons for Pruning in Gilbert

Gilbert’s climate offers two optimal windows:

Season Ideal Pruning Tasks Why It Works
Late Winter (Feb‑Mar) Structural pruning, crown reduction Tree is dormant, reducing sap loss.
Early Fall (Sep‑Oct) Thinning, disease removal Leaves are out, allowing clear visibility.

Attempting heavy pruning in summer can stress trees due to heat and low soil moisture. Our certified arborists schedule work around local weather patterns to ensure optimal outcomes.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: How often should I have my trees pruned?

Most mature trees benefit from pruning every 3‑5 years. Fast‑growing species (e.g., eucalyptus) may need annual attention.

Q2: Will pruning harm my tree?

No. When performed by certified arborists, pruning encourages healthy growth and reduces disease risk.

Q3: What is the difference between trimming and removal?

Trimming shapes and maintains a living tree; removal eliminates the entire tree, often followed by stump grinding.

Q4: Do I need a permit for tree removal in Gilbert?

Yes, the City of Gilbert requires a permit for trees larger than 12 inches DBH (Diameter at Breast Height). We handle the paperwork for you.
